My brother is running a Honda CBR 600 RR 2005 with HRC ECU. We are wanting to fit a quickshifter to it but are unsure if the HRC ECU supports the quickshifter. On my sidecar (GSX R-600 with Yoshi), you can just plug a quickshifter into the side stand switch and the Yoshi will control the cutting of the ignition etc.

I have been doing a bit of reading up and some sites say I can plug a quickshifter into the horn connections and the HRC ECU will work this way (although I cannot see any adjustments for kill time etc in the HRC software). Other sites say that the HRC ECU only supports the HRC quickshifter.

What options are there? Power commander ignition module? Quickshifter that incorporates an ignition module (HM?).
